Solution for 22(10x+5y)=200 equation:


Simplifying
22(10x + 5y) = 200
(10x * 22 + 5y * 22) = 200
(220x + 110y) = 200

Solving
220x + 110y = 200

Solving for variable 'x'.

Move all terms containing x to the left, all other terms to the right.

Add '-110y' to each side of the equation.
220x + 110y + -110y = 200 + -110y

Combine like terms: 110y + -110y = 0
220x + 0 = 200 + -110y
220x = 200 + -110y

Divide each side by '220'.
x = 0.9090909091 + -0.5y

Simplifying
x = 0.9090909091 + -0.5y
